Transaction 2dd56dfb636b20cff77693a67aa716db6b3cafaf80c4a60ca286a9a5e571792a
1 Input
1 Output
-
2dd56dfb636b20cff77693a67aa716db6b3cafaf80c4a60ca286a9a5e571792a:0
- value
- 2366746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b50f72f8fe5c02d338a36fbac55a9c08663e335 OP_EQUAL
- address
- 3LE4657X9nWEhSkJH3E5ddUyNJnKEc2wCU